Nestled in the heart of Buckinghamshire, Princes Risborough Train Station is your gateway to a seamless travel experience. Whether you’re commuting for work or planning a leisurely escape, this well-connected station offers a wide range of facilities to make your journey as smooth as possible.
Princes Risborough Station is well-equipped to meet your needs. The ticket office is open from 6:00 AM to 6:50 PM on weekdays, with reduced hours on weekends, ensuring ample time to purchase or collect your tickets. Similarly, ticket machines are available, which are accessible to all, making it easy for everyone to grab a ticket on the go. Smartcards, however, cannot be issued or validated at this location, so plan accordingly.
For those that require a bit of extra assistance, the station offers staff help, customer service points, and even an induction loop for hearing aid users. Step-free access throughout the station, including platform lifts, ensures that everyone can traverse the platforms with ease.
The station offers a plethora of transport links: there's a reliable rail replacement service and taxi rank conveniently situated at the entrance. Local bus services, like the number 320 operated by Redline Buses, offer connections to nearby Bledlow and Chinnor. For comprehensive travel planning, a handy guide is available for download here.
This station acts as a springboard to several popular destinations. Hop on a train from Princes Risborough to explore the vibrant streets of London Marylebone or enjoy a more tranquil outing to Oxford. Football fans will find direct routes to Wembley Stadium, ideal for catching a game or a concert.
Other notable destinations include High Wycombe and Birmingham New Street, making Prince Risborough a junction for both local and long-distance journeys.
When it comes to comfort, a coffee shop is on hand for a quick refreshment, though amenities like ATMs and shops are absent, so be sure to grab essentials beforehand. Parking fans will appreciate the ample space—319 spots—including facilities for bicycles with CCTV protection.

Clapham Junction is not just a train station; it's an iconic gateway offering seamless travel across London and beyond. Known as one of the busiest railway stations in Europe by train traffic, it is the hub that connects commuters with not only different parts of London but also with various key locations in the UK. At Clapham Junction, you'll find a range of facilities to make your visit comfortable and efficient. The ticket office is open from 06:15 to 21:30 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 07:15 to 21:30 on Sundays. There are ticket machines available, including accessible ones for those with disabilities. If you’re planning to collect tickets you bought online, you can do so easily at the station ticket machines.
The station is equipped with essentials for travelers with reduced mobility, offering step-free access through the Brighton Yard entrance via lifts. Although there is no waiting room, seating areas are provided, and assistance is readily available for anyone needing an extra hand to navigate the station. For newcomers or anyone needing directions, the help points, ticket office, and information points ensure someone is there to help. Though there is no dedicated luggage storage, CCTV is present for added security.
Clapham Junction offers splendid connectivity via various transport modes. If you need bus services, just by stepping out to the Grant Road or St Johns Hill, you can find bus stops equipped for your journey needs. Rail replacement services also operate from designated bus stops, effectively connecting you even if train services face disruptions. Cycling enthusiasts can hire Santander Bikes to get around, making it easy to explore the surrounding areas in an eco-friendly way.
Clapham Junction is a launchpad for exploring London and beyond. Among the most sought-after routes are journeys to London Waterloo, London Victoria, and Gatwick Airport. Whether you’re heading to Wimbledon, Shepherd’s Bush, or even East Croydon, Clapham Junction ensures you arrive punctually and comfortably.
While waiting for your train, indulge in the refreshment facilities; food and drinks are within easy reach right inside the station. If you need cash, ATM machines are available, although currency exchange isn’t provided. And for bike lovers, 294 bicycle spaces with excellent security features, such as locks and CCTV, give peace of mind.
